Title: New York Giants baseball player Admiral Schlei, leaning forward to catch a baseball, standing on the field at West Side Grounds Description: Informal full-length portrait of Admiral Schlei, baseball player for the National League's New York Giants, leaning forward and holding his hands in front of him to catch a baseball, standing on the field at West Side Grounds, located between West Polk Street, South Wolcott Avenue (formerly Lincoln Street), West Taylor Street, and South Wood Street in the Near West Side community area of Chicago, Illinois. An unidentified Giants player is standing next to Schlei, and Giants players are standing in the background. Date Depicted: 1909 Creator: Chicago Daily News, Inc.
